What Stops Will You Visit?
Stop 1: Main Street – This part of the tour is all about local finds and island culture. You might browse for handmade crafts, sample local rum, or visit historic sites—whatever fits your vibe. The flexible timing (about an hour) means your guide can cater to your interests, whether that’s shopping or simply soaking in the sights.
Stop 2: Charlotte Amalie Overlook – Here, you’ll pause at one of the most beautiful vantage points on the island. Expect breathtaking views, perfect for photos and relaxing for a few moments of quiet. The review mentions it as a serene hideaway, ideal for unwinding and appreciating the natural beauty of St. Thomas.
Stop 3: Local Lunch – A highlight is the authentic island meal served at a favorite local spot. The reviews rave about the fresh, flavorful food and the relaxed setting, often eaten seaside or on a beach. It’s a chance to enjoy true local cuisine rather than touristy fare.
Stop 4: Charlotte Amalie West – The day ends with a relaxing beach stop—feet in the sand, swimming, sunbathing, or just chilling out. The water equipment and beach chairs are included, making this a hassle-free way to unwind. Many reviews mention how this laid-back time is the perfect finale to a day of exploration.
What’s Included and What to Expect
This tour covers transportation in an air-conditioned vehicle, with WiFi onboard—a small but appreciated perk for sharing photos or checking messages. You’ll also get bottled water and snorkeling equipment (if you choose to snorkel), making your adventure comfortable and easy.
Lunch is included, but only for paying guests—so bring your appetite! The experience is tailored for easygoing travelers who want to relax and enjoy the island without rigid schedules.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is this tour suitable for all ages? Yes, most travelers can participate, and the relaxed pace makes it accessible for families, couples, or solo travelers looking for a laid-back day.
Does the tour include hotel pickup? Yes, pickup is offered, and the small group size helps keep logistics simple and efficient.
What should I wear? Comfortable clothing suitable for warm weather, with sunscreen, sunglasses, and a hat for sun protection. Beachwear is recommended if you plan to relax at the beach.
Is there time for shopping? The tour focuses on scenic, cultural, and relaxing stops, with many reviews noting the absence of long shopping delays, but some flexibility exists for spontaneous browsing.
Can I customize the itinerary? Absolutely. The guide will tailor the day based on your interests, whether that’s beaches, viewpoints, or local cultural spots.
Are meals included? Yes, a local lunch is part of the experience for paying guests, offering a taste of authentic island cuisine.
What if it rains? The tour is weather-dependent. If canceled due to poor weather, you’ll be offered a different date or a full refund.
Is snorkeling equipment provided? Yes, snorkel gear is included if you wish to explore under the water.
